5:28 Instead of using magnets, you could have made the display passively stable in both positions by slightly offsetting the center of rotation past the midline of the box, so that it would rotate eccentrically In the vertical position it would want to fall away from the turning side, and turning it to the horizontal position would cross over the axis of rotation and put the center of mass further from the center.

One thing to note here, these LED matrix panels suck a LOT of current. You'd need a beefy power supply like 5V 4A and some even recommend 5V 8A. Would love to see power consumption overtime of this device and power saving features (like lowering brightness at idle or turning off entirely or a habd hover turn on feature).
